Shaved Ice!!! (Zero Degrees)

It’s just so so so so so so bad of me to forget the complete name of this shaved ice shop at Robinson’s Pioneer’s food court. I know it’s Zero Degrees, but I’m not quite sure of the spelling. Plus, people might mistake it for that yogurt brand that carries the same name.

Anyway…

Lookee!!

The concept is somewhat similar to a snow cone, except it looks prettier. It’s also a great deal creamier. I never thought shaved ice could be so creamy!

Best of all, it’s a cheap treat. I had three toppings on this large bowl of shaved ice — large enough for me to think I wouldn’t be able to finish it — and yet the entire thing only cost around PhP90. (Most yogurt and ice cream shops these days would charge around PhP200 for what I just had.)
